WebMay 29, 2024 · In chemistry, ionization often occurs in a liquid solution. Is the sun ionized gas? “Most of the atoms in the Sun are ionized. This is particularly true in the hot, dense interior, where essentially all the hydrogen and helium atoms are completely ionized. Such a highly ionized gas is called a plasma. Part of this is due to the chemical reactions that ions have with your ... discovery toys builders benders and moreWebJul 19, 2024 · A weak electrolyte is an electrolyte that does not completely dissociate in aqueous solution. The solution will contain both ions and molecules of the electrolyte.
